 After hearing Blue Highway in concert at the Southern Music Rising I have been listening to Sirius Channel 65 more often and decided to download a few songs off of iTunes.  I bought Crooked Still’s latest a week ago and tonight I ended up downloading three songs from three differnt artist that I have heard over the past week. 

The first was a track by Tony Trischka off of his Double Banjo Bluegrass Spectacular record called The Crow.   I first heard this song this week while driving to Panama City for a deposition and could not stop listening to it.  It is an upbeat instrumental with some good picking.  The video above is Tony Trischka, Steve Martin and Bela Fleck performing this song on the Late Show.  It rocks!

The second song was Midnight Train to Mephis by the SteelDrives.  I heard them play it on the Grand Ole Opry a couple of weeks ago and really liked how they sounded.  The lead singer has a soulful voice that kind of reminds me of the guy from Blues Traveler.  This song would be perfect to listen to on the patio with a cold beer.

The final song was Tallahassee by Cherryholmes.  I have heard quite a bit of Cherryholmes’ latest album on Sirius, but this song was off their first record.  I was intrigued by the snippet I heard on iTunes and decided to give it a try.  Like The Crow, this song is an intrumental but instead of the banjo being front and center the fiddle is featured.  This song is quite good.

Listening to these three song makes me look forward to the 2nd Annual Southern Music Rising next year.  It also makes me want to pack up the truck and head up to North Carolina for a weekend in the mountains.
